HAN@Punggol Year 1 (2025-2026)

Getting to Know You

Our work in Punggol started with a simple ambition: to get to know the neighbourhood and the people who call it home. We spent a year listening, building relationships, and understanding the stories that shaped Punggol past and present.  

JUNE 2025

Saying Hello

We introduced ourselves to the neighbourhood with Colours on Shore, a co-created  installation by Mit Jai Inn that invited families to leave their marks together. It became a shared space where strangers could meet, create, and imagine what this journey could become.

Artist-led workshops by whoeatsart and Zai Tang explored Punggol through food, sound, and the landscape of Coney Island. They opened up new ways of engaging with Punggol’s past, asking how earlier histories might still connect with residents today.

Over 11 days, we met over 1,500 residents. For 3 in 5 of them, it was their first time attending an arts or heritage event.

AUGUST 2025 ONWARDS

Door-Knocking & House Warmings

Through door-knocking, we gathered everyday stories. We met over 500 residents and listened intently to their experiences of daily life, favourite places, hopes for the future, and what it means to build community in one of Singapore's newest towns.

We also launched House Warmings, an initiative supporting residents to host casual afternoon gatherings for neighbours in their own homes. Around food and conversation, these casual gatherings created easily-accessible opportunities for neighbours to get to know one another.

As Cherrin, one of our host-collaborators puts it, “We discovered Singaporean’s aren’t unwilling to communicate. They just need the right opportunities. Once there are the right activities and platforms, residents are naturally willing to come out, gather and interact.”

SEPTEMBER 2025 - MARCH 2026

Neighbourhood Storybook

Alongside today's residents, we also met people who remembered an earlier Punggol. Their memories of kampungs, farms, coastlines, and everyday life became part of the Neighbourhood Storybook that connects present with past through storytelling.

MARCH 2026

Punggol Open House

To close the year, we brought the neighbourhood together for a weekend festival celebrating everything we had learnt. Through a Call for Collaboration, residents got the opportunity to step into the role of storytellers themselves, leading programmes that shared their own perspectives on Punggol. It marked a shift from listening to creating together.

Year One by the Numbers

>15,000 Residents engaged
2,256 Doors knocked
27 Programmes
1,623 Volunteer hours
30+ Partners

What’s Next

Year One laid a foundation for our understanding of the neighbourhood. The relationships, stories, and trust built over the past year now become starting points for deeper collaboration.

In Year Two - Shaping Our Stories, we move from listening to co-creation, developing new programmes with residents, artists, and community partners that reflect Punggol's evolving identity.
